River Thames: river restriction notice for exercise between Hurley and Temple Locks
Published 9 September 2019
1. When
Thursday 12 September 2019 from 10am to 1pm.
2. Where
Near Harleyford Marina, between Hurley and Temple locks.
3. Details
University of Buckinghamshire Medical School, Buckinghamshire Fire and Rescue Service and Thames Valley Police are carrying out an emergency water rescue exercise in the area outside Harleyford Marina between Hurley lock and Temple lock. During the exercise, a passenger vessel will be simulated to be in distress with multiple casualties.
The Environment Agency will have patrol launches based upstream and downstream of the exercise. If you are navigating in this area during this time you will be given directions from their officers on duty. It is not anticipated that navigation will close during this exercise. Please continue navigating your journey past this area without stopping. This is to ensure the safety of both the exercise participants and other River Thames users.
